Quantitative Developer – Early London Hire (Front Office) – London – Multi-Strategy Hedge Fund – Up to £400k TC

A leading global investment manager (~$25bn+ AUM) is building out its London technology platform and hiring a key Quantitative Developer as part of that expansion.

This is a front-office role reporting directly to the Head of Development, working closely with portfolio managers and trading desks across London and Europe.

Today, the majority of the engineering team sits in the US. London is a strategic growth hub — and this hire is expected to become the go-to engineer on the ground, owning relationships with PMs and traders and driving the build-out of local capability.

The Role

This is a highly hands-on role focused on rebuilding and scaling core trading and risk infrastructure.

Key areas of focus:

  • Building and evolving real-time PnL and risk systems (moving away from slower, batch-driven workflows)
  • Designing pricing and risk infrastructure (scenario analysis, stress testing, margin replication)
  • Working directly with PMs and quants to productionise trading signals across asset classes
  • Developing data pipelines and interactive tooling for portfolio managers
  • Acting as the primary technical counterpart for London-based desks, bridging trading and engineering

You’ll be solving problems around data scale, latency, and system reliability, in an environment where requirements are often loosely defined and speed of iteration matters.

What They’re Looking For

  • 5+ years in a front-office or trading-aligned engineering role
  • Strong Python (NumPy, Pandas) with solid software engineering fundamentals
  • Experience working with market data, time-series data, or real-time systems
  • Strong stakeholder skills — comfortable working directly with traders and PMs
  • SQL proficiency; exposure to additional languages (C#, R, etc.) beneficial
  • Background in a quantitative discipline (CS, Maths, Physics, Engineering, etc.)
